Tibolone in the prevention and treatment of postmenopausal osteoporosisShort communications

J. Vokrouhlická

Clin Osteol 2008; 13(1): 12-16

For over 20 years, tibolone has been used for the treatment of vasomotor symptoms and for the prevention of osteoporosis in postme­ nopausal women. Thanks to its unique, tissue-specific metabolism, it was included in the group of selective tissue estrogenic activity regulators (STEARs). Tibolone decreases bone turnover to an extent similar to that in hormonal therapy and increases bone mineral density in both younger and older postmenopausal women. Chronic pancreatitis and metabolic osteopathiesNews

H. Dujsíková, P. Dítě, J. Tomandl, A. Ševčíková, M. Mišejková, M. Pfiecechtělová

Clin Osteol 2008; 13(1): 17-22

Chronic pancreatitis is an inflammatory disease manifested by maldigestion and in an advanced stage by malabsorption. The aim of our research was monitoring the occurrence of metabolic osteopathies (osteopenia, osteoporosis and osteomalacia ) in patients with chronic pancreatitis. The group consisted of 73 patients (17 women a 56 men) in different stage of chronic pancreatitis. In all patients were determined serum concentrations of Ca, P, 25-OH vitamin D, 1,25 (OH)2 vitamin D, alkaline phosphatase and its bone izoen­ zym.
